which of the following types of statement cannot be used to explain the steps of a proof? check all that apply
postulate
theorem
guess
conjecture

Explanation:

Brief Explanations

In mathematical proofs, a postulate is an accepted statement without proof, a theorem is a proven statement, both can explain proof steps. A guess is an unsubstantiated assumption, and a conjecture is a proposed statement without proof (not yet a theorem), so they can't be used to explain proof steps as they lack the necessary validity or proof.

Answer:

C. Guess, D. Conjecture
